US electricity demand and grid capacity
Is US electricity demand outrunning the capacity being built to serve it?
US electricity net generation was 354,690.53 million kilowatthours in 2026-05-01, up 3.1 percent over one year, a move at the 65th percentile of its one-year changes.

Hypotheses
- Electricity system enables Economic output Hypothesized
Stated, not yet evidenced here: electricity access allows productive uses (lighting, machinery, refrigeration, communications) that raise output per person. The catalog carries both series; no causal study is attached.
- Electricity system enables Human health and longevity Hypothesized
Stated, not yet evidenced here: electricity access allows refrigeration of vaccines and food, lighting in clinics, water pumping and a shift away from solid cooking fuels, all of which bear on mortality. The catalog carries both series; no study is attached.
Unknowns
- Data-center load growth is announced, not metered; the stored series cannot separate it from other demand.
- Interconnection queue withdrawal rates are not ingested, so the share of the planned pipeline that completes is not known from stored data.
